Johan Wolfgang von Goethe is known as a celebrated German poet, however, his scientific accomplishments have remained rather unknown. Yet, Goethe had a keen interest in all the science of his time and he has written a number of books and writings on mineralogy, geology, botany, morphology, osteology, zoology, meteorology, chemistry, physics and chromatics.

This work concentrates on Goethe's studies of prismatic color phenomena and the formation of rainbows from a phenomenological point of view, they are also compared to the Newtonian physics of the time. 48 color photographs are included which illustrate the studied phenomena. Goethe's phenomenological way of doing science can be said to be complementary to way of mathematical physics.

Raimo Rask has worked as a teacher and lecturer at Snellman.College in Helsinki, now retired. His special interests have been phenomenological philosophy and Goethe's way of science.
